#324813 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#324813 is composed of 19.6% red, 28.2%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 73.6% yellow and 71.8% black. It has a hue angle of 84.9 degrees, a saturation of 58.2% and a lightness of 17.8%. #324813 color hex could be obtained by blending #649026 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

Shades and Tints of #324813

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070a03 is the darkest color, while #fcfef9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#324813

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2e302c is the less saturated color, while #355a01 is the most saturated one.
